Transaction e32cf6de3bec229a20212d4640928b6289caf75736dbd521c8d259fd3184e732
1 Input
1 Output
-
e32cf6de3bec229a20212d4640928b6289caf75736dbd521c8d259fd3184e732:0
- value
- 454857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ed9ef9db2db5886f594293307f7a8ae35a70181d OP_EQUAL
- address
- 3PMSWrUDcZKpTpQ2FKmx4tiFTs5mfQxigT